drippinginfromthenewsposts...11/16/2005 1:45:23 PM - by CURE:ROBERT
SO!WHY NO NEWS POSTS?BECAUSE THERE IS NO REAL NEWS AS SUCH TO POST?I AM WRAPPING UP THE NEXT RE-ISSUES WITH VARIOUS PEOPLE - THE BLUE SUNSHINE, TOP, THOTD AND KMKMKM DELUXE EDITIONS - COMPILING EXTRAS CD'S, REMASTERING THE SOUND, FIXING THE BOOKLETS UP...ALL SCHEDULED FOR RELEASE IN SPRING 2006...WRITING SOME FILM MUSIC...CHOOSING THE BEST DEMOS...GETTING THE WORDS RIGHT...PUTTING TOGETHER A 5.1 LIVE SUMMER 2005 DVD THING...LIVING...WE WILL NOW NOT BE IN THE STUDIO 'FOR REAL' UNTIL JANUARY 2006...BUT WE ARE STILL ON COURSE FOR A SUMMER RELEASE AS IT'S ALL IN THE PREPARATION!LATER...LOVEROBERTPSTHE REASON WE ARE NOT ON THE LIVE8 DVD IS BECAUSE 'THEY' WANTED 'HITS'... A long long time ago...
I argued with a girl in a record shop in Ayr about who spotted a bargain copy of "Blue Sunshine" first. It was me, but I'd left it in search of other bargains, intending to come back to it and stupidly figuring no-one else would lift it in the meantime. I was passing the counter and to my horror I saw her about to pay for it. I argued and cajoled and pleaded with her to let me buy it instead, even offering to buy it off her at a profit, but to no avail. So I left the shop, empty handed and disconsolate.
About an hour later she appeared in front of me in the town centre, said "This means more to you than me", kissed me, handed me the record, and walked away.
I never even caught her name...
